Sample Sign Requirements in Tallulah Falls

Sign TypeMax HeightMax AreaSetback
Incidental Use Sign - Directional or Information Sign (Public/Quasi-public)15 sq ft
Accessory Use Sign - Real Estate (For Rent, Lease, or Sale of Premises)4 sq ft
Accessory Use Sign - Business Identification (Accessory Use)8 sq ft
